I made the mexican chicken and rice dish which was in the December mag for dinner last night - it was SO good. Even fussy DH liked it. I had leftovers for my lunch today Grin Anyone else tried it? Really easy. Here's the recipe:

serves 4 (or 2 greedy people plus lunches)

Using fry light, spray 8 chicken thighs and brown them on both sides in a frying pan - 8-10 mins. Take out and rest on a plate.

Gently fry 3 finely chopped onions and two large garlic cloves for around 10 mins, with a few more sprays of fry light if the pan is dry.

Add the following to the onions: 2 tsp ground cumin, 2tsp sweet smoked paprika, 1 tsp chilli flakes, and 300g basmati rice. Fry for another 1-2 mins making sure all the rice is covered.

Into a shallow but large oven dish, put the rice mix on the bottom, layer on 4 whole peppers cut into strips (I only had 2 red peppers), and place chicken on top. Then pour over 650ml chicken stock. Cover in foil and bake for 35/40 mins*.

The recipe says bake for 30 mins but my chicken was pink and I had to put it back in.

MisForMumNotMaid · 04/02/2015 15:38

Did you weigh at the same time of day?

Did you wear the same amount of clothes?

Did you eat/ drink just before weighing yourself?

My weight varies by exactly 3lb night to morning and my clothes add typically about 1.5lb but up to 3lb again. So in theory thats upto 6lb variation whilst maintaining! (Chipping that exclamation is just for you, i've never seen exclamation mark rage before, it made me smile)

I'm a home weigher. I know I shouldn't, but I do. Its a hard habit to break. I am thinking about trying to slowly drop off to alternate days etc and go by feel of clothes.
